BEIJING - China reported its highest daily total of new coronavirus cases in two months on Sunday and infections in South Korea also rose, showing how the disease can come back as curbs on business and travel are lifted.

Meanwhile, Egypt reported its biggest daily increase on Saturday. Infections were rising in some U.S. states as President Donald Trump pushed for businesses to reopen despite warnings by public health experts.  RELATED: Stay up to date on all coronavirus-related informationChina had 57 confirmed cases in the 24 hours through midnight Saturday, the National Health Commission reported.
